Disposal of the old air conditioner
Before disposing an old air conditioner that goes out of use, please make sure it's inoperative and safe. Unplug the air conditioner in order to avoid the risk of child entrapment.
It must be noticed that air conditioner system contains refrigerants, which require specialized waste disposal. The valuable materials contained in a air conditioner can be recycled. Contact your local waste disposal center for proper disposal of an old air conditioner and contact your local authority or your dealer if you have any question. Please ensure that the pipework of your air conditioner does not get damaged prior to being picked up by the relevant waste disposal center, and contribute to environmental awareness by insisting on an appropriate, anti-pollution method of disposal.
Disposal of the packaging of your new air conditioner
All the packaging materials employed in the package of your new air conditioner may be disposed without any danger to the environment.
Consult your local authorities for the name and address of the waste materials collecting centers and waste paper disposal services nearest to your house.

Purging method: to use vacuum pump
Liquid stop valve
1 .Detach the service portis cap of 3-way valve, the valve rod's cap for 2-way valve and 3-way valves, connect the service port into the projection of charge hose (low) for gaugemanifold. Then connect the projection of charge hose (center) for gaugemanifold into vacuum pump.
2 .Open the handle at low in gaugemanifold, operate vacuum pump. If the scale-moves of gause (low) reach vacuum condition in a moment, check 1 again.
3 .Vacuumize for over 15min. And check the level gauge which should read -0.1MPa (-76 cm Hg) at low pressure side. After the completion of vacuumizing, close the handle 'Lo' in the vacuum pump. Check the condition of the scale and hold it for 1-2min. If the scale-moves back in spite of tightening, make flaring work again, then return to the beginning of 3 .
4 .Open the valve rod for the 2-way valve to and an angle of anticlockwise 90 degree. After 6 seconds, close the 2­way valve and make the inspection of gas leakge.
5 .No gas leakage?
In case of gas leakage, tighten parts of pipe connection. If leakage stops, then proceed 6 steps.
6 .Detach the charge hose from the service port, open 2­way valve and 3-way. Turn the valve rod anticlockwise until hitting lightly.
7 .To prevent the gas leakage, turn the service ports cap, the valve rodis cap for 2-way valve and 3-way's a little more than the point where the torque increases suddenly.

Wiring work
1. Electric wiring Note:
The air conditioner must use special circuit , and wiring by the qualified electrician according to the wiring rules specified in national standard. The grounding wire and the neutral wire shall be strictly separated. Connect the neutral wire with grounding wire is incorrect. The electric leakage breaker must be installed. All the electric wire must be copper wire.When wiring,there shall keep a proper distance between the power line and communication wire to avoid twist together. Otherwise,signal disturbance will occur,and the air conditioner can not operate normally. Power supply: 1PH, 220-230V~, 50Hz. The wiring method of power line is Y connection. If the power line is damaged, in order to avoid risk of electric shock, it must be replaced by the manufacturer or its repair center or other similar qualified person.The connecting cable must be shielded. Fuse: T3.15A 250VAC T25A 250VAC (Please check with the outdoor unit wiring diagram.) Please check the circuit diagram about the fuse replaced.
2. Wiring method Wiring method of orbicular terminals For the connection wire with orbicular terminals, its wiring method is as shown in the right figure: remove the connecting screw, put the screw through the ring on the end of the wire, then connect to the terminal block and fasten screw. Wiring method of straight terminals For the connection wire without orbicular terminals, its wiring method is: loosen the connection screw, and insert the end of the connection wire completely into the Terminal block, then fasten the screw. Slightly pull the wire outwards to confirm it is firmly held.

Test running
Before starting the test running, please confirm the following works have been done successfully.
1) Correct piping work;
2) Correct wiring work;
3) Correct match of indoor and outdoor unit;
4) Proper recharge of refrigerant if needed;
5)Correct indoor unit addresses setting. Make sure that all the stop valves are fully open. Check the voltage supplied to the outdoor and indoor units, please cinfirm that is 230V.
Test running.
1) If the temperature is lower than 16 OC, it is impossible to test cooling with remote controller, and also when the temperature is higher than 30 OC, it is impossible to test heating.
2) To test cooling, set the lowest temperature at 16 OC. To test heating,set the highest temperature, at 30OC.
3) Please check both cooling and heating operation of each unit individually and then also check the simultaneous operation of all indoor units.
4)After ruuning the unit for about 20 minutes, check the indoor unit outlet temperature.
5) After the unit is stopped, or working mode changed, the system will not start again for about 3 minutes.
6)During cooling operation, frost may ocur on the indoor unit or pipes, this is normal.
7) Operate the unit according to the operation manual. Please kindly explain to our customers how to operate through the instruction manual.
